Summary

Plankton, algae and fish larvae are useful indicators of ecosystem complexity, environmental health and water quality. The small size, fleeting life-stages and environmental sensitivity of these organisms increases their ability to respond rapidly to environmental change. Regular monitoring aids environmental management by helping to identify pollution, invasive species, Harmful Algal Blooms and climate change effects. This project seeks to build local capability and capacity by expanding existing protocols for monitoring microscopic marine organisms and linking these with public health objectives
